Key Characteristics of Counterfeit Money
Comprehending how to recognize counterfeit notes assists in the fight versus this problem. Here are some typical characteristics that assist in detection:

Watermarks: Genuine currency typically features unique watermarks that are challenging to duplicate.

Microprinting: Small text that is hard to see with the naked eye however is present on legitimate notes is often missing or duplicated improperly on counterfeit costs.

Feel and Texture: Genuine money is printed on a distinct type of paper, providing it a specific feel. Counterfeit notes often feel different, as they might be printed on routine paper.

Security Threads: This ingrained thread is a typical security feature in many banknotes.

In spite of these functions, counterfeiters have invented significantly advanced techniques that sometimes can deceive even careful people.
The Legal Landscape of Counterfeiting
Counterfeiting is a criminal offense in virtually every nation in the world. The legal implications can be serious, incorporating whatever from substantial fines to considerable prison sentences. Moreover, legislation is continuously adjusted to deal with brand-new techniques of counterfeiting.

In the United States, for instance, the Secret Service was originally founded to combat currency counterfeiting and has actually stayed at the leading edge of this battle. They utilize various strategies, consisting of public education, to help people determine counterfeit money.

1. What is counterfeit money?
Counterfeit money is an imitation of currency that tries to duplicate genuine expenses with the intent to trick and defraud those who accept it.
2. How can I tell if a costs is counterfeit?
To determine counterfeit bills, analyze the watermark, color-shifting ink, microprinting, and feel of the note, amongst other security functions usually provide in genuine currency.
3. What should I do if I get a counterfeit bill?
If you suspect you have gotten counterfeit currency, do not try to utilize or circulate it. Instead, report it to regional law enforcement or the pertinent financial organization.
4. Is it unlawful to have counterfeit money?
Yes, having counterfeit money can cause criminal charges, consisting of fines and imprisonment. It is vital to avoid any association with counterfeit currency.
5. Can counterfeit money appear like real money?
Yes, modern-day counterfeit money can be rather persuading, frequently simulating real currency closely due to sophisticated printing strategies. However, cautious evaluation usually reveals discrepancies.
